Our verdict is Uncertain significance. The variant received 1 ACMG points: 1P and 0B. PP2
The NM_000079.4(CHRNA1):c.575A>G(p.Glu192Gly) variant causes a missense change. The variant allele was found at a frequency of 0.0000787 in 1,613,920 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★★).

Genes affected
CHRNA1 (HGNC:1955): (cholinergic receptor nicotinic alpha 1 subunit) The muscle acetylcholine receptor consiststs of 5 subunits of 4 different types: 2 alpha subunits and 1 each of the beta, gamma, and delta subunits. This gene encodes an alpha subunit that plays a role in acetlycholine binding/channel gating. Alternatively spliced transcript variants encoding different isoforms have been identified. [provided by RefSeq, Nov 2012]

Our verdict: Uncertain_significance. The variant received 1 ACMG points.
PP2
Missense variant in the gene, where a lot of missense mutations are associated with disease in ClinVar. The gene has 16 curated pathogenic missense variants (we use a threshold of 10). The gene has 5 curated benign missense variants. Gene score misZ: 0.72157 (below the threshold of 3.09). Trascript score misZ: 1.6771 (below the threshold of 3.09). GenCC associations: The gene is linked to lethal multiple pterygium syndrome, congenital myasthenic syndrome 1A, myasthenic syndrome, congenital, 1B, fast-channel, postsynaptic congenital myasthenic syndrome.
